Abstract :
Fullerene relaxation occurs under impulsive deformations: pressure, tension, shear and shear +pressure combinations are considered in this work. The empiric pair Lennard-Jones potential was used as the intermolecular interaction potential. The deformation range, where the crystal behaves elastically, was investigated. The wave generation and loss of crystal stability characters is dependent on stress type allowing the level to be deduced. As a result of this research, four main phases of crystal relaxation were discovered: (1) stable phase—homogeneous stable deformed crystal; (2) waves of static fullerene chains generating displacement; (3) dislocation generation. It was shown that there are several main relaxation types inside the frame of Hookeʹs law dependent stress type and its level.
